Henry Cloete (1792-1870) was the first Recorder of Natal and very learned in Roman-Dutch law as used in Natal. The British government regarded him highly because of his services to them in conducting a kind of census of all the original farms granted to the Voortrekkers between 1839 and 1843.

Professor Alan Frederick Hattersley (1893-1976) was born in Leeds, England, in 1893. He studied History at Cambridge and on completing his degree was invited to come out to South Africa and lecture in history at the new Natal University College (NUC) in 1916.
